    • 釋義

    名詞

    • 1. an individual leaf of paper or parchment, either loose as one of a series or forming part of a bound volume, which is numbered on the recto or front side only.
    • the page number in a printed book.
    • 2. a sheet of paper folded once to form two leaves (four pages) of a book.
    • a size of book made up of folio sheets of paper.
    • a book or manuscript made up of folio sheets of paper; a volume of the largest standard size.
